The S3C2440 Core Board I is based on the high performance Samsung S3C2440 ARM920T processor which works at up to 400MHz. The board has 64MB SDRAM and 64MB NAND Flash and integrates a wide range of peripherals like Mini USB Host/Device interface, Mini SD Card interface, Ethernet interface, Audio I/O interface, etc. It supports WindowsCE4.2/5.0, 6.0 and Linux2.6 and can be used to many fields, such as handheld device, medical appliance, etc.
LCD Display interface, supports various size of LCD Panels
Audio I/O interface
Ethernet interface
JTAG interface
Full-featured communication serial interface
Extend all the I/O interfaces, convenient for the further development
Variety of power supply methods
Dimension: 85 x 54 x 1.6mm
Six PCB layers, stable and reliable performance

Introduction of SAMSUNG's S3C2440A
SAMSUNG's S3C2440A is designed to provide hand-held devices and general applications with low-power, and high-performance microcontroller solution in small die size. To reduce total system cost, the S3C2440A includes the following components.
The S3C2440A is developed with ARM920T core, 0.13um CMOS standard cells and a memory complier. Its lowpower, simple, elegant and fully static design is particularly suitable for cost- and power-sensitive applications. It adopts a new bus architecture known as Advanced Micro controller Bus Architecture (AMBA).
The S3C2440A offers outstanding features with its CPU core, a 16/32-bit ARM920T RISC processor designed by Advanced RISC Machines, Ltd. The ARM920T implements MMU, AMBA BUS, and Harvard cache architecture with separate 16KB instruction and 16KB data caches, each with an 8-word line length. By providing a complete set of common system peripherals, the S3C2440A minimizes overall system costs and eliminates the need to configure additional components. The integrated on-chip functions includes:
Around 1.2V internal, 1.8V/2.5V/3.3V memory, 3.3V external I/O microprocessor with 16KB I-Cache/16KB DCache/MMU
External memory controller (SDRAM Control and Chip Select logic)
LCD controller (up to 4K color STN and 256K color TFT) with LCD-dedicated DMA
4-ch DMA controllers with external request pins
3-ch UARTs (IrDA1.0, 64-Byte Tx FIFO, and 64-Byte Rx FIFO)
2-ch SPls
IIC bus interface (multi-master support)
IIS Audio CODEC interface
AC'97 CODEC interface
SD Host interface version 1.0 & MMC Protocol version 2.11 compatible
2-ch USB Host controller / 1-ch USB Device controller (ver 1.1)
